心靈之曲
浏览量7120    |    粉丝0    |    关注0
  • 心靈之曲

    心靈之曲

    2025-11-17 12:11:10
    PHP教程:利用Session安全高效地在不同文件间传递用户变量
    本教程详细阐述了如何在PHP应用中,通过使用Session机制安全高效地在不同文件间传递用户变量,例如从登录页面获取用户名并在其他页面(如数据查询页面)中使用。文章涵盖了Session的启动、变量的存储与检索,并强调了相关安全最佳实践,确保数据在整个用户会话期间的可用性和完整性。
    237
  • 心靈之曲

    心靈之曲

    2025-11-17 12:16:02
    告别多重登录困扰:如何用jeremy379/laravel-openid-connect轻松为LaravelPassport增添OpenIDConnect身份验证能力
    在构建现代Web应用时,尤其是涉及多个子系统或需要与第三方服务集成时,用户身份验证和授权常常成为一个复杂且关键的挑战。我们常常会遇到这样的需求:用户在一个应用中登录后,希望在其他关联应用中无需再次登录,即实现单点登录(SSO)。虽然LaravelPassport为我们提供了强大的OAuth2授权能力,但它主要关注的是资源访问的授权,而非用户身份的验证。当我们需要一个可靠的方式来确认“谁”正在访问时,Passport就显得力不从心了。
    723
  • 心靈之曲

    心靈之曲

    2025-11-17 12:16:21
    CSS纯加载动画:解决伪元素初始延迟与同步问题
    本文旨在解决CSS纯加载动画中,当使用animation-delay为伪元素(::before,::after)设置延迟时,动画在hover触发后可能无法立即呈现预期异步效果的问题。我们将分析该现象的根源,并提供一种通过调整animation-delay设置,实现加载动画即时错位旋转的解决方案,同时介绍Chrome开发者工具在动画调试中的应用。
    822
  • 心靈之曲

    心靈之曲

    2025-11-17 12:16:41
    Go语言中url.QueryEscape的深入理解与应用实践
    url.QueryEscape是Go语言net/url包中的一个关键函数,用于对URL查询字符串中的特殊字符进行URL编码。它通过将不安全的字符转换为百分比编码格式(%HH),确保数据在作为URL参数传递时不会损坏或改变URL结构,从而保障Web应用能够正确解析和处理传递的参数。
    756
  • 心靈之曲

    心靈之曲

    2025-11-17 12:16:53
    Go项目依赖管理与Vendoring实践:使用Godep构建稳定服务
    本教程探讨Go服务项目中管理vendored依赖的挑战,特别是为满足法律合规和高可用性要求而固定依赖版本时。文章将介绍如何利用godep工具优雅地解决GOPATH冲突,实现依赖的精确版本控制,从而避免复杂的环境脚本,确保项目结构清晰和构建过程稳定。
    607
  • 心靈之曲

    心靈之曲

    2025-11-17 12:18:10
    解决JavaScript Canvas中drawImage不显示图片的问题
    在使用JavaScript动态创建Canvas并尝试绘制外部图片时,ctx.drawImage方法可能无法正常工作,而其他绘图操作如fillRect却能成功。这通常是由于图片尚未完全加载完成就尝试绘制导致的异步问题。核心解决方案是利用图片的load事件监听器,确保图片资源加载完毕后再执行drawImage操作,从而避免在图片未就绪时进行绘图,确保图片正确显示。
    829
  • 心靈之曲

    心靈之曲

    2025-11-17 12:18:49
    纯CSS实现视口内图像无限循环滚动教程
    本文详细介绍了如何利用CSS动画实现一个图像在视口内无限循环滚动的效果,作为已废弃的MARQUEE标签的现代替代方案。通过@keyframes定义动画路径,结合transform:translateX()精确控制元素位置,使图像能够平滑地从视口右侧移动到左侧并无限重复,同时提供了具体的HTML和CSS代码示例及关键属性解析,帮助开发者轻松实现这一视觉效果。
    302
  • 心靈之曲

    心靈之曲

    2025-11-17 12:25:27
    PHP中带时区日期字符串的稳健解析与转换
    本文详细介绍了在PHP中如何使用DateTime对象高效且准确地解析包含时区信息的日期字符串,例如"2021-12-10T18:49:00-05:00"。通过利用DateTime的内置功能,可以轻松地初始化日期对象,并进行不同时区之间的灵活转换,避免了strtotime在处理带时区信息时可能出现的解析错误,确保日期处理的精确性和一致性。
    421
  • 心靈之曲

    心靈之曲

    2025-11-17 12:26:25
    Swiper.js教程:实现多张幻灯片分组滑动
    本教程详细指导如何在Swiper.js中配置幻灯片分组滑动功能。通过利用slidesPerGroup参数,开发者可以轻松实现每次点击导航按钮时,同时移动多张幻灯片,而非逐一滑动。这对于展示多列内容(如产品列表或图片画廊)的轮播图尤其有用,能显著提升用户体验和内容展示效率。
    416
  • 心靈之曲

    心靈之曲

    2025-11-17 12:27:05
    JavaScript Canvas实现可等分旋转圆盘及频闪效应模拟
    本教程详细指导如何在HTML5Canvas上绘制一个可等分、旋转的圆盘,并模拟频闪效应。文章通过优化现有JavaScript代码,展示了如何将圆盘精确划分为多个等份,并为其中特定部分着色。此外,教程还探讨了频闪效应中采样频率与旋转频率之间的关系,特别是可能导致180度相位变化的特殊情况,并提供了完整的实现代码。
    569

最新下载

更多>
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号